Action item from the Ordercrest incident: enforce soft deletes on the orders table. Hard deletes during the purge job removed rows still referenced by the refund worker, causing the page storm. Add the deleted_at guard to all purge paths and block direct DELETE grants for service accounts. Migration steps, rollback notes, and the verification query are on the internal remediation page.

operations page: https://confluence.nelvroworks.example/dash/spaces/board/job/pipeline/issue/spaces/b9c0f0fbc164027c4eb481af

☐ Step 4 — Autocomplete index check. On-call: before key rotation, confirm the Larkfield suggest index is rebuilt; p95 latency must be under 120ms. Slow shards on quill-node-3 were the last blocker — drain and reindex if needed. Do not proceed to HSM activation until the dashboard is green. When cleared, unseal the backup partition with the recovery passphrase that follows.

vault phrase of fahog-yajog = frawyn-jordor-casael-gormir-olieth-julmir

## Deployment

Plugins run under the Pinekiosk watchdog. The watchdog restarts the app on hang, crash, or heartbeat loss. Plugins must not block the main loop for more than two seconds or they will be killed. Ship your plugin bundle to the kiosk's plugins directory; the watchdog picks it up on the next cycle. No hot reload. Restart behavior and timeouts are controlled by the values below.

service settings:
PRAWYN_PIN=9848
PRAWYN_METRICS_HOST=metrics.prawyn.lumicworks.corp
PRAWYN_LOG_LEVEL=warn
PRAWYN_TENANT=pelius

## Configuration

Gossamer sits as a bloom filter in front of the Pebblecache KV store, so most misses never hit disk. Tune GOSSAMER_BITS and GOSSAMER_HASHES in .env — defaults are fine for under ten million keys, honestly. The filter snapshots to the backing store every five minutes. For the snapshot writer to authenticate against Pebblecache, add this line next:

env line for fafof-fahag: LEDGER_TOKEN5=f8790